Finding GCD of 673, 202, 194, 398 using Prime Factorization

Given Input Data is 673, 202, 194, 398

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 673 is 673

Prime Factorization of 202 is 2 x 101

Prime Factorization of 194 is 2 x 97

Prime Factorization of 398 is 2 x 199

The above numbers do not have any common prime factor. So GCD is 1
